What Crofty's fans are failing to remember is that when he took all those wickets, he was a good bowler with his tail up.

He has suffered a major dip in form that is reflected in his rising average and has lost confidence. He bowled a very poor line against the Windies such that they hardly had to play a ball and his one wicket was a very generous lbw decision.

The selectors had to resort to Such in Australia due to Crofty's yips.

The boyo needs a good season in county cricket bowling the off stump line that got him all those wickets before he gets another run in the team.

On Schofield, I can only say that the England selectors have a habit of picking a youn cricketer and then dropping him without hardly ever playing him, Ashley Cowan, Graham Swann spring quickly to mind and there is almost a player per season who is treated like this.

On helpful wickets in Bangladesh on the last A team tour, Schofield bowled sides out. We could do a lot worse than pick him and play him. The point about Warne's ear;y career has been well made. I wish our selectors had been in charge of Australia as they would have never picked Warne again!
